I upgraded lab to lv5 and i donāt have any intentions to go any further.
Lab lv5 allow me to do 2 alchemy at the same time, and it is the last level without gems requirements.
Alchemy are painfully long and require a crazy lot amount of ham.
I use it exactly to get rid of my ham surplus and get some more axe and bombs for the monthly event. Thatās it.
After months of alchemy i still have just 6.000 shards, so do not bother for that.
High levels suppose to be more worth it, but thereās much better ways to use gems probably.
